Cheltenham man takes on 1,000 mile journey for charity
Wednesday, March 31, 2010, 11:55

CHRIS Ludlow is banking on helping heroes with an epic 1,000-mile bike ride.

The 26-year-old, who works for Cheltenham & Gloucester in Barnwood, will cycle from Land's End to John O'Groats for Help for Heroes, which supports the Armed Forces.

He decided to take on his challenge of a lifetime after being dared by his friends.

Chris, of Burton Street, Cheltenham, said: "I was watching the rugby with a group of friends when one of them said his brother was cycling around Italy.

"I said it wouldn't be that hard to cycle from Land's End to John O'Groats and the rest was history.

"I'm really excited about doing it, but there's a bit of apprehension because I'll be on my own and I've never done something like this.''
